:root {
  /* --default-font-family: "DM Sans", sans-serif; */
  --default-font-family: "Montserrat", sans-serif;
  --menu-prime-color: #fff;
  --primary-color: #30863f;
  --primary05: var(--primary-color, 0.5);
}
.app-header {
  height: 100px;
  /* position: relative; */
}

.app-sidebar {
  /* position: relative; */
}

[data-nav-layout="horizontal"] .app-sidebar {
  inset-block-start: 100px;
  /* inset-block-start: 0px; */
  background-color: #30863f;
  border-bottom: 2px solid #ba8e3a;
  font-family: var(--default-font-family);
}

[data-nav-layout="horizontal"] .app-content {
  margin-block-start: 180px;
  /* margin-block-start: 0px; */
}

[data-nav-style="menu-click"][data-nav-layout="horizontal"]
  .app-sidebar
  .side-menu__item:hover {
  background-color: #ba8e3a;
}

@media (min-width: 992px) {
  [data-nav-style="menu-click"][data-nav-layout="horizontal"]
    .app-sidebar
    .side-menu__item {
    padding: 15px 10px;
  }
}

.card.custom-card {
  border-radius: 12px;
}

@media (min-width: 992px) {
  .footer {
    padding-inline-start: 0px;
  }
}

[data-nav-layout="horizontal"] .main-menu-container .slide-left,
[data-nav-layout="horizontal"] .main-menu-container .slide-right {
  display: none !important;
}

.app-sidebar .side-menu__item,
.app-sidebar .side-menu__label {
  color: #fff;
}

.app-sidebar .side-menu__icon {
  color: #fff;
  fill: #fff;
}
